狗年旺旺

Hello, it's me, LL, on Chinese New Year greeting duty again. The slave had decided that like last year, I should have a festive photograph taken. You would think that it being the year of the dog, I would have more say. No such luck for me. The slave did not want me to pose with mandarin oranges since I pounced on them. I was caught peeing on the potted plants so I was forbidden from going near those too. In the end, I had to take my photograph with a stupid paper bag. To protest the indignity of it, I sulked throughout the photography session.

Being a responsible canine, I will still do what the slave wants me to do. I wish everyone a prosperous Chinese New Year. Woof woof!

A Good Start

I am back! Shopping was blah. The local labels had disappointing offerings this season and the shoes I wanted were sold out. Certainly did not expect my best buy to be the Microplane grater that was on sale. Fared better when it came to food with the highlight being dinner at Tetsuya's. Just give me some time to organise the write up and photographs.

An ex colleague gave me tickets to catch the new year's eve fireworks. Y, thank you for your generosity. Thus we ushered in 2006 standing on the Cahill Expressway which overlooks the Sydney Habour Bridge where the fireworks were set off. I wished I had better photos to show but the front was crowded and my camera had bad flash. The fireworks still looked spectacular from where I was standing though, a truly excellent start to the new year.
